body { background: #FFF; margin: 0; font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if; font-size: 10px; color: #787979; background: #DEDEDE; }
a { font-size: 10px; color: #787979; text-decoration: none; }
a:hover {text-decoration:underline;}
h1,h2,h3 { font-size: 14px; margin: 0;}
h1 { line-height: 55px; vertical-align: middle; }
h1 img { vertical-align: middle; }
h3 { margin: 5px 0; padding: 0; font-weight: normal; }
img { border: 0;}
table { width: 100%; text-align: center; }
td { border: 1px solid #DEDEDE; }
.glo { text-align: center; font-weight: bold; }
.pg { width: 695px; margin: 0 auto; }
.tgr { height: 35px; background: #333; border: 1px solid #CCC; }
.logo { background: #fff; width: 199px; float: left; height: 150px; vertical-align: bottom; text-align: center; border-left: 1px solid #CCC; border-top: 1px solid #CCC; border-bottom: 1px solid #CCC; }
.ltop { margin: 0; background: url('/_iMg/top.jpg') 0 0; float: right; width: 493px; height: 150px; border: 1px solid #CCC; }
.ltop span { display: none; } 	
.obr { margin-top: 55px; }
.logo2 { width: 199px; float: left; }
.ltop2 { float: right; width: 493px; border-left: 1px solid #CCC; }
.tlog12 { background: #fff; border: 1px solid #CCC;}
.scroll { clear: both; height: 25px; border-left: 1px solid #CCC; border-right: 1px solid #CCC; }
.tex { margin: 30px; }
.ltex { margin: 20px; } 
.kos img { float: left; margin: 0 15px 0 0;  }
.stop { background: #DEDEDE; text-align: right; margin: 3px;  }
.stop a { font-size: 9px;}
.stop2 { clear: both; }
#menu2{margin:0 0 0 2px;padding:0;list-style:none;}
#menu2 li{margin:0 5px 5px 0;}
#menu2 a {font-size: 11px;}
#menu2 a.selected{text-decoration:underline;}
#menu1{float:right;padding:10px 15px 0 0;}
#menu1 a{margin-left:10px;font-weight:bold;font-size:12px;text-decoration:none;text-transform:uppercase; color: #FFF;}
#menu1 a.selected, #menu1 a:hover {border-bottom: 1px solid #FFF;}
.kontakt { text-align: center; padding: 20px 0;}
